# Artifact Signing — GarageFeed

The Stackerton occupancy feed ships as a signed bundle. Support: if a customer reports a verification failure, confirm they pulled the latest bundle, not a cached one. Unsigned bundles are never valid; escalate immediately. To check a bundle on a customer's behalf, verify it against the current signing key below.

deploy key for kajof-yawif: bky9_fvxrpdHPq

## Audio waveform preview — who to contact

The waveform preview in Soundloft is owned by the Media Rendering group. They handle rendering bugs, peak-detection accuracy, and zoom performance. Upload pipeline issues belong to the Ingest team instead, so check where the failure occurs before filing. Include the clip duration and sample rate in any report. For rendering questions, contact the owning group.

escalation mailbox, hahif-bagag: kasix_praok_ulaath@halixforge.test

Action item (SEV-2 follow-up): Session-token refresh in Cardmere silently failed when refresh requests raced a logout, leaving users in a half-authenticated state. Fix shipped; support should no longer advise cache clears. If a customer reports repeated sign-outs after this week's release, escalate rather than reapplying the old workaround. The full incident timeline, symptom checklist, and escalation steps are on the internal page below.

dashboard of yafog-fajof = https://jira.tolvaqsys.internal/pages/pages/projects/49fe21c4